Ironic for Shafie to talk about championing people's needs: Musa

SANDAKAN: Parti Warisan Sabah (Warisan) president is being ironic when he talked about championing people’s needs when Datuk Seri Shafie Apdal failed to do so when he was the Federal minister.

Sabah Chief Minister Tan Sri Musa Aman said Shafie, who was now a puppet of the Tun Mahathir Mohamad-led opposition alliance, was being hypocritical when he suddenly raised issues such as Malaysian Agreement 1963 (MA63).

“He is now working with Mahathir, the very person who failed the people of Sabah for the 22 years he was in office as the Prime Minister by not recognising the significance of Malaysia Day, let alone speak of the Malaysia Agreement 1963 (MA63),” he said at an event here.

Musa said unlike him, when Prime Minister Datuk Seri Najib Razak took over office, Najib gave recognition to Malaysia Day on Sept 16 by declaring it a national holiday and called for the Royal Commission of Inquiry on the large presence of immigrants in Sabah.

“Now Shafie wants to find an end to the MA63 issue within a short period of time. He is just trying to fool the people and gain political mileage to chase his dream,” he said.

Musa said when Shafie was the Rural and Regional Development Minister, he was entrusted with a major task to bring more development across the country, including Sabah, but instead the ministry became entangled with a series of mismanagement issues and being oblivious to developments in Sabah.

Musa, at another occasion at his official residence Sri Gaya in Kota Kinabalu this afternoon, met with top leadership of Parti Bersatu Sabah (PBS), United Pasokmomogun Kadazandusun Murut Organisation (Upko) as well as Parti Bersatu Rakyat Sabah (PBRS).

The three Kadazandusun Murut (KDM) parties had agreed to work in unison for the benefit of all in Sabah and the country.

The three parties briefed him on the recent first presidential council meeting outcome, which was also to strengthen unity, understanding and cooperation between them to face the coming election.

The respective party presidents/acting presidents, Tan Sri Joseph Pairin Kitingan (PBS), Datuk Seri Panglima Madius Wilfred Tangau (UPKO) and Tan Sri Joseph Kurup (PBRS) had met with Musa who is also Sabah Barisan Nasional Chairman to hand over an official report on the formation of the presidential council.
